FAQ

What is the maximum input voltage for each channel?

The comparator inputs can handle voltages up to the supply voltage (12 V) without damage, but it is recommended to keep the input range within 0‑10 V for optimal performance.

Can the module be used with microcontrollers that operate at 3.3 V?

Yes. The LM393 output is an open‑collector type, allowing you to pull the output up to 3.3 V with an external resistor, making it compatible with 3.3 V logic levels.

Is there any built‑in hysteresis to prevent rapid toggling?

The basic module does not include fixed hysteresis, but you can add external resistors to create the desired hysteresis level for noisy environments.

How do I connect the module to a breadboard?

Simply align the module’s pin header with the breadboard rows, ensuring VCC connects to a 12 V rail, GND to ground, and the input pins to the signals you wish to compare. The output pins can then be routed to your microcontroller or relay driver.
